    If you decide to handsplit, do yourself a favor and get an old tire to put the rounds (that will fit) into while splitting. Easily the best thing that's helped me in my years of handsplitting. The thing that hurts your back the most IMO is bending over to pick up the log and resetting it after every strike, but with the tire method it's just whack, whack, whack around the round and the tire keeps it all in place. And if you're really good, after every strike the maul bounces up off the tire back into position for the next strike! :coolsmirk:
